Funkcijas EDate un EOMonth
Attiecas uz: Pamatnes programmām Darbvirsmas plūsmas Modeļa vadītas programmas Power Pages
Datuma/laika vērtībai tiek pieskaitīti vai atņemti mēneši, neobligāti koriģējot mēneša dienu.
Apraksts
Funkcijas EDate un EOMonth pārvieto datumu/laiku uz priekšu vai atpakaļ par noteiktu mēnešu skaitu.
Pēc mēneša korekcijas EDate atstāj dienas daļu nemodificētu, ja vien jaunā vērtība nav pēc mēneša beigām. Piemēram, pārceļot 31. jūliju atpakaļ par vienu mēnesi, iegūst 30. jūniju. Izmantojiet EDate , lai aprēķinātu dzēšanas datumus vai izpildes datumus, kas iekrīt tajā pašā mēneša dienā, kurā ir emisijas datums.
Pēc mēneša korekcijas EOMonth maina dienas potionu uz iegūtā mēneša pēdējo dienu. Izmantojiet EOMonth , lai aprēķinātu dzēšanas datumus vai izpildes datumus, kas iekrīt mēneša pēdējā dienā. EOMonth var izmantot, lai pārvietotu datumu/laiku uz mēneša beigām, pievienojot nulli mēnešu.
Visas funkcijas atgriež vērtību Date. Laika komponents nav iekļauts, pat ja tāds bija ievades datumā/laikā.
Skatiet sadaļu darbs ar datumiem un laikiem, lai iegūtu papildinformāciju.
Sintakse
EDate( DateTime,NumberOfMonths )
- DateTime - nepieciešams. Datuma/laika vērtība, kurā jādarbojas.
- NumberOfMonths - nepieciešams. Mēnešu skaits, lai pievienotu vai atņemtu dateTime. Pozitīva vērtība dod nākotnes datumu, negatīva vērtība dod pagātnes datumu, un nulle nemaina visu ievades datuma laiku .
EOMonth(DateTime,NumberOfMonths )
- DateTime - nepieciešams. Datuma/laika vērtība, kurā jādarbojas.
- NumberOfMonths - nepieciešams. Mēnešu skaits, lai pievienotu vai atņemtu dateTime. Pozitīva vērtība dod nākotnes datumu, negatīva vērtība dod pagātnes datumu, un nulle maina ievades DateTime dienas daļu uz mēneša beigām.
Piemēri
EDate
Formula | Apraksts | Rezultāts |
---|---|---|
EDate( Datums(2023,5,15), 4 ) | Pieskaita četrus mēnešus 2023. gada 15. maijam, atstājot datumu nemainīgu. | Datums(2023,9,15) |
EDate( Datums(2023,5,15), -1002 ) | No 2023. gada 15. maija atņem 1,002 mēnešus, atstājot datumu nemainīgu. | Datums(1939,11,15) |
EDate( Datums(2023,5,15), 0 ) | Pievieno nulles mēnešus 2023. gada 15. maijam, atstājot mēnesi un gadu nemainīgu, kā arī atstāj datumu nemainīgu. | Datums(2023,5,15) |
EDate( Datums(2023,5,31), 1 ) | Pievieno vienu mēnesi 2023. gada 15. maijam, pielāgojot datumu kopš jūnija, nav tik daudz dienu kā maijā. | Datums(2023,6,30) |
EOMonth
Formula | Apraksts | Rezultāts |
---|---|---|
EOMonth( Datums(2023,5,15);, 4 ) | Pievieno četrus mēnešus 2023. gada 15. maijam, pārceļot datumu uz mēneša beigām. | Datums(2023,9,30) |
EOMonth( Datums(2023,5,15);, -1002 ) | Atņem 1,002 mēnešus no 2023. gada 15. maija, pārceļot datumu uz iegūtā mēneša beigām. | Datums(1939,11,30) |
EOMonth( Datums(2023,5,15);, 0 ) | Pieskaitot nulli mēnešu 2023. gada 15. maijam, atstājot mēnesi un gadu nemainīgu, datumu pārvietojot uz nemodificētā mēneša beigām. | Datums(2023,5,31) |
EOMonth( Datums(2023,5,31);, 1 ) | Pievieno vienu mēnesi 2023. gada 15. maijam, pārceļot datumu uz iegūtā mēneša beigām. | Datums(2023,6,30) |